Full job descriptionA highly successful and rapidly expanding wealth management business is seeking an experienced Senior Paraplanner to join its growing technical team.
This is an excellent opportunity for a technically strong Paraplanner who enjoys working on complex client cases and wants to take on a broader role that includes technical leadership, mentoring and quality oversight.
Working closely with Financial Planners, you will be responsible for producing high-quality research, analysis and financial planning recommendations across a wide range of client scenarios. You will also provide guidance and support to junior members of the team, helping to drive consistency, quality and best practice throughout the paraplanning function.
Key Responsibilities:
*Conduct in-depth research across pensions, investments, tax planning and protection solutions
*Prepare and review complex suitability reports and financial planning recommendations
*Produce detailed cashflow modelling and scenario planning
*Work closely with Financial Planners to develop bespoke client solutions
*Review, sense-check and sign off paraplanning reports
*Provide technical guidance, mentoring and support to Paraplanners and Junior Paraplanners
*Liaise with providers regarding technical queries and policy information
*Ensure advice remains compliant with FCA and regulatory standards
*Support process improvements and contribute to best practice initiatives
*Participate in technical projects, committees and working groups across the business
Candidate Requirements:
*Chartered Financial Planner status or demonstrably close to achieving Chartered status
*Minimum of five years’ experience within Paraplanning or Technical Financial Planning
*Strong knowledge of pensions, investments, tax planning and protection products
*Experience using cashflow modelling and financial planning software
*Excellent analytical, communication and report-writing skills
*Passion for technical financial planning and mentoring others
Package:
*£55,000 - £68,000 basic salary
*Annual bonus of up to 10%
*Comprehensive benefits package
*Hybrid working (3 days office / 2 days home)
*Strong support towards continued professional development
*Opportunity to take on technical leadership responsibilities
*Clear long-term career progression opportunities
